Confidence Is Face of DStv Mobile

Barely a week into her exit from the Big Brother Amplified reality series, Ghana�s outspoken rep, Confidence Haugen has chalked her first endorsement deal as the face of DStv Mobile in Ghana. The surprise revelation was made at a press conference in Accra to welcome the Big Brother �diva� back home to Ghana. This came as a welcomed surprise for the Big Brother housemate, who had hinted in her interactions with the press that she hopes to do more brand endorsements with her newly found fame. She described her statement about not needing the $200,000 cash prize as a misrepresentation by the media but rather meant that with the experience from the show, she would be walking away with more than $200,000. Truly, things can only get better for Confidence, from this point on. According to her, her drive is to truly highlight the entertainment scene in Ghana with her popular Aphrodisiac Nightclub being just the tip of the iceberg. Her media outfit, Venus is set to roll out TV shows highlighting the true essence of showbiz, the essence of her and her birthplace, Ghana, whilst giving others a run for their money. She outlined a rather bold plan including a future talk show, cook show, a reality TV series via her media outfit, as well as a number of charity project. Children, and breast cancer in particular are causes Confidence identifies with and she intends to be at the forefront of these causes. She said her �Project Smile� campaign will be used to perform surgeries for birth deformities for children. As part of her new role as Brand Ambassador for DStv Mobile in Ghana, Confidence also received a Nokia 5330 handset with 15 DStv Channels and a year of free subscription on DStv Mobile.
